Key Responsibilities

  • Orders, interprets, and evaluates appropriate laboratory and diagnostic tests
  • Develops appropriate plans of care and follow-up based on the outcomes of diagnostic, laboratory, and physical examination findings
  • Performs bedside procedures as are appropriate to the patient population
  • Diagnoses and treats any complications of their weight management intervention(s) in conjunction with attending physician
  • Evaluates for and initiates consults with specialists on an as-need basis
